Birch Tree Pruning in Allentown, PA
Birch tree pruning services involve selectively trimming and shaping birch trees to promote healthy growth, enhance appearance, and prevent potential hazards. This process typically includes removing dead or diseased branches, reducing overgrowth, and maintaining the desired size and form of the tree. Homeowners often request this service to improve the safety of their property, prevent branches from interfering with structures or power lines, and to keep their landscape looking tidy and well-maintained.
Before requesting birch tree pruning, property owners usually want to understand the scope of the work, including which branches will be removed and how the pruning will affect the tree’s health and appearance. It’s also helpful to consider the timing of pruning, as certain seasons are better suited for trimming to minimize stress on the tree. Clarifying these details ensures that the pruning aligns with the health and aesthetic goals of the landscape.

Common Birch Tree Pruning Jobs
Birch Tree Pruning Services - Proper pruning enhances tree health and promotes balanced growth.
Tree thinning - Removing select branches reduces wind resistance and improves air circulation.
Structural pruning - Corrects branch angles and removes weak or damaged limbs for safety.
Formative pruning - Shapes young birch trees to develop strong, attractive structure.
Deadwood removal - Eliminates dead or diseased branches to prevent decay and pest issues.
Maintenance pruning - Maintains aesthetic appeal and supports overall tree vitality.
Birch Tree Pruning Questions
What is tree pruning for birch trees? Tree pruning involves removing dead or overgrown branches to maintain health and appearance.
When is the best time to prune a birch tree? The ideal time is during late winter or early spring before new growth begins.
Why should property owners consider pruning birch trees? Proper pruning helps prevent disease, improves safety, and promotes healthy growth.
What types of pruning are common for birch trees? Crown thinning, crown reduction, and deadwood removal are typical pruning methods used.
